GENERAL MAINTENANCE

•  Good maintenance is your responsibility. Poor maintenance is an invitation to trouble. 
•  Always use proper tools or equipment for the job at hand. 
•  Use extreme caution when making adjustments.
•  Never use your hands to locate a hydraulic leak on attachments. Use a small piece of cardboard or wood. Hydraulic fluid 

escaping under pressure can penetrate the skin.

•  Hydraulic fluid escaping under pressure can penetrate skin and cause injury. 
•  Fluid accidentally injected into the skin must be surgically removed within a few hours by a doctor familiar with this form 

of injury or gangrene may result.

•  When disconnecting hydraulic lines, shut off hydraulic supply and relieve all hydraulic pressure. 
•   Clean hydraulic oil daily for contamination. If contamination is present, determine the source and correct the problem. 
•  When replacing bolts refer to this manual. 
•  Clean the exterior of the unit with a mild detergent and water to remove any debris and grime. 
•  Paint all scratched or bare metal surfaces.
•  Check and tighten all bolts, nuts, and screws.
•  Repair or replace any cutting head components that are damaged or worn.
•  Check the gearbox for sufficient amount of oil.
•  Check the PRO-DIG

™ 

Auger Drive output shaft for bends, cracks, breaks, or wear. Replace if any of these conditions appear.

CHECKING AND CHANGING THE GEAR OIL

The Planetary gearbox used on your 

PRO-DIG

™  

Drive Head uses a gear oil to keep the internal gears lubricated. 

To check and or replace the oil, follow these simple steps.
CHECKING THE GEAR OIL:

1.  Make sure the PRO-DIG

™  

Auger Drive unit is in an upright 

position when checking the oil. 

2.  Slowly loosen the oil fill-drain plug located on the under 

side of the gearbox. As you reach the end of the threads on 
the plug, oil should start to come out.

3.  If you see oil starting to pour out of the port, quickly retighten 

the plug. This is an indication that the oil level is adequate, but 
in order to correctly measure the amount of oil, the gearbox 
should be drained and the correct amount of oil replenished. 
See “Changing Gear Oil” section for oil capacity.

CHANGING THE GEAR OIL:

1.  Position the PRO-DIG

™  

Auger Drive unit in a position in 

which the oil can flow freely from the gearbox once the 
plug is removed. 

2.  Place a drain pan under the drain port that will hold at 

least one gallon of oil.

3.  Remove the drain plug and allow the oil to completely drain out. 
4.   Position the gearbox for filling by orientating the unit so that 

the same port used for draining can now be used to fill.

5.   Fill the gearbox with 0.75 Gallons/2.84 Liters of gear oil. 

See oil specifications below.

LUBRICATION AND MAINTENANCE

The oil should be changed after the first 50 hrs. of use and at 
500 hr. intervals thereafter. Geardrives in auger drives require 
GL-5 grade EP 80/90 gear oil for lubrication. PRO-DIG

™ 

recom-

mends that the unit be partially disassembled to inspect gears 
and bearings at 1000 hr. intervals.
